The Early Years of Gavin Newsom

So, where is Gavin Newsom from originally? Gavin Newsom was born in San Francisco, California, on October 10, 1967. Being a native of the Golden Gate City, his early life was deeply intertwined with the vibrant culture and diverse communities of the Bay Area. Growing up in San Francisco, Newsom experienced the unique blend of innovation, activism, and natural beauty that defines the region. His parents, Tessa Thomas and William Newsom III, played significant roles in shaping his values and aspirations. His father was a judge and attorney, and his mother was a homemaker who later worked in various non-profit organizations. This upbringing instilled in him a sense of public service and community involvement. Newsom attended elementary and high school in the Bay Area, developing a strong connection to the local environment and its people. Early Career and Political Beginnings

Before diving headfirst into the political arena, Gavin Newsom carved out a successful career in the business world. His entrepreneurial spirit led him to establish the PlumpJack Group, a collection of wineries, restaurants, and hotels. This venture not only demonstrated his business acumen but also provided him with valuable insights into the challenges and opportunities faced by small business owners. Newsom's early career in the private sector shaped his understanding of economic development and job creation, which would later inform his policy decisions as a politician. His foray into the business world also honed his leadership skills, teaching him how to manage teams, make strategic decisions, and navigate complex challenges. Building the PlumpJack Group from the ground up instilled in him a strong work ethic and a commitment to excellence. His success in the business world paved the way for his entry into politics, providing him with the financial resources and managerial experience necessary to launch a successful campaign. In 1996, Newsom's political journey began when he was appointed to the San Francisco Board of Supervisors. This marked the start of his career in public service, where he quickly gained a reputation for his innovative ideas and his willingness to challenge the status quo. As a member of the Board of Supervisors, Newsom championed policies aimed at addressing homelessness, improving public transportation, and promoting economic development. Gavin Newsom's Tenure as Mayor of San Francisco

Gavin Newsom's tenure as the Mayor of San Francisco from 2004 to 2011 marked a pivotal chapter in his political career. During his time in office, he implemented a range of innovative policies and initiatives aimed at addressing some of the city's most pressing challenges.
